The Windows-based IMO Bookshelf software (v.5.13) was retired on 30 April 2024. From 1 May 2024, all digital IMO publications are available only in the new IMO Bookshelf format.

The rules prescribe requirements for ship design, construction, equipment, crewing, operation and tonnage measurement, … Web17 feb. 2012 · The tricky situation this presents is that most software will apply the requirements of one jurisdiction at a time; the user would be required to pick either 49 CFR or the IMDG Code, but not both. If the user picks 49 CFR, then UN 3469 would not exist as described above.
